Step Up for The Resonance Centre

The Resonance Centre is a brand new community health and wellbeing hub creating positive and powerful change in Clayton, Manchester.

The Resonance Centre is a unique space positioned just minutes from Manchester's city centre. It provides a wealth of health and wellbeing activities for the local community including yoga, meditation, nutritional eating, drumming, dancing, digital inclusion, sober events, radio and podcasting, and much more.

In only two years, The Resonance Centre has undergone a radical transformation- turning a kitchen showroom into the incredible community space it is today. The Resonance Centre has offered free space and affordable room hire to local groups to run activities and now, it needs your help.

The Journey So Far

From Kitchen Showroom to Community Space

Juanita Margerison, Director of The Resonance Centre and Silver Spoon Kitchens, began on her own health and wellness journey in 2016.

After revolutionising her lifestyle with yoga, mindfulness, clean eating and other practices, Juanita came up with the dream of creating her kitchen showroom into a wellness hub to offer health and wellbeing activities to the community free of charge. 

Fellow Director, Ralph Sweeney, came on board in 2019 to help the dream of The Resonance Centre grow. They registered as a Community Interest Company in May 2020 at the start of the Covid-19 pandemic. 

The team began offering online classes to support people at home throughout the pandemic, all while refurbishing the centre. 

1648822862_217009983_3059647720937997_5591270169239024941_n.jpg

Following a seven month renovation, The Resonance Centre saw a radical transformation from a kitchen showroom to a spacious, contemporary studio with endless uses and benefits for the whole community. 

1648822974_1648822973457.png

1648823002_1648823000893.png

Since opening in the summer of 2021, The Resonance Centre has delivered well over 1,000 hours of yoga, meditation, pranayama classes and workshops. 

1648823171_1648823170860.png

Juanita and Ralph continue to work tirelessly on a voluntary basis to run The Resonance Centre, working weekdays, evenings and weekends to deliver a space that brings the whole community together for positive, powerful change.

What's On Offer

The Resonance Centre has a jam-packed schedule of amazing activities which desperately require the co-ordination and scheduling of a Centre Manager. 

 Activities include, but are not limited to: 

  • Weekly children's yoga sessions with local schools
  • Little Yogis- Saturday morning children's yoga classes
  • Yin & Tonic- A weekly yin yoga class with calming bedtime drinks
  • Transform Yoga- Trauma informed yoga for recovery
  • The Digital Inclusion Hub- Three weekly digital drop-in sessions offering support to those digitally isolated with online support, equipment and mobile data
  • The Manchester Wellness Collective- A dedicated collective of holistic professionals, yoga teachers and specialist practitioners 
  • Born Free- Manchester's conscious dance floor for weekly sober raving
  • Drumming Workshops
  • Integrating Self- Healing trauma from a holistic perspective commissioned by Manchester City Council
  • Drywave Recovery- Drywave Recovery is a CIC supporting people in recovery from drugs and alcohol through peer support, radio, podcasting, sober music events and intensive support workshops. The organisation has a studio space based in The Resonance Centre.

Unity in the Community

The Resonance Centre is fully integrated into the Clayton community, with strong partnerships and referral pathways to provide holistic support and wrap-around care to anyone accessing the centre. 

The centre has co-created a collaborative working environment with other local community organisations. It is now home to a range of groups including Step Up MCR, Drywave CIC, Flourish Together and many others making use of the space.

About Step Up MCR

Step Up MCR is the place-based giving charity creating powerful change in communities from the inside out. With a focus on the Manchester wards Ancoats & Beswick and Clayton & Openshaw, we work to build more connected communities by increasing local giving to community-led projects. 

Our aim is to create more resilient communities and address local inequalities by boosting community activity, raising aspirations and increasing health and wellbeing. We do this by brokering support between resident-led projects and those wanting to give back, and creating spaces for people to discuss and gain support for community-led projects. In promoting local giving, we unlock access for anybody to give back to the community- whether its time, money, resources, skills, knowledge or space.

As well as supporting giving to established local organisations and projects, Step Up MCR aims to be the catalyst for new and emerging ideas to develop and grow into sustainable projects. We do this by working in partnership with residents, businesses, voluntary groups or public sector bodies to increase giving.
